| describe("parsePageRange", () => { |
| it("parses a single page number", () => { |
| expect(parsePageRange("3", 20)).toEqual([3]); |
| }); |
|
|
| it("parses a page range", () => { |
| expect(parsePageRange("1-5", 20)).toEqual([1, 2, 3, 4, 5]); |
| }); |
|
|
| it("parses comma-separated pages and ranges", () => { |
| expect(parsePageRange("1,3,5-7", 20)).toEqual([1, 3, 5, 6, 7]); |
| }); |
|
|
| it("clamps to maxPages", () => { |
| expect(parsePageRange("1-100", 5)).toEqual([1, 2, 3, 4, 5]); |
| }); |
|
|
| it("deduplicates and sorts", () => { |
| expect(parsePageRange("5,3,1,3,5", 20)).toEqual([1, 3, 5]); |
| }); |
|
|
| it("throws on invalid page number", () => { |
| expect(() => parsePageRange("abc", 20)).toThrow("Invalid page number"); |
| }); |
|
|
| it("throws on invalid range (start > end)", () => { |
| expect(() => parsePageRange("5-3", 20)).toThrow("Invalid page range"); |
| }); |
|
|
| it("throws on zero page number", () => { |
| expect(() => parsePageRange("0", 20)).toThrow("Invalid page number"); |
| }); |
|
|
| it("throws on negative page number", () => { |
| expect(() => parsePageRange("-1", 20)).toThrow("Invalid page number"); |
| }); |
|
|
| it("handles empty parts gracefully", () => { |
| expect(parsePageRange("1,,3", 20)).toEqual([1, 3]); |
| }); |
| }); |

| describe("native PDF provider API calls", () => { |
| const priorFetch = global.fetch; |
| const mockFetchResponse = (response: unknown) => { |
| const fetchMock = vi.fn().mockResolvedValue(response); |
| global.fetch = Object.assign(fetchMock, { preconnect: vi.fn() }) as typeof global.fetch; |
| return fetchMock; |
| }; |
|
|
| afterEach(() => { |
| global.fetch = priorFetch; |
| }); |
|
|
| it("anthropicAnalyzePdf sends correct request shape", async () => { |
| const { anthropicAnalyzePdf } = await import("./pdf-native-providers.js"); |
| const fetchMock = mockFetchResponse({ |
| ok: true, |
| json: async () => ({ |
| content: [{ type: "text", text: "Analysis of PDF" }], |
| }), |
| }); |
|
|
| const result = await anthropicAnalyzePdf({ |
| ...makeAnthropicAnalyzeParams({ |
| modelId: "claude-opus-4-6", |
| prompt: "Summarize this document", |
| maxTokens: 4096, |
| }), |
| }); |
|
|
| expect(result).toBe("Analysis of PDF"); |
| expect(fetchMock).toHaveBeenCalledTimes(1); |
| const [url, opts] = fetchMock.mock.calls[0]; |
| expect(url).toContain("/v1/messages"); |
| const body = JSON.parse(opts.body); |
| expect(body.model).toBe("claude-opus-4-6"); |
| expect(body.messages[0].content).toHaveLength(2); |
| expect(body.messages[0].content[0].type).toBe("document"); |
| expect(body.messages[0].content[0].source.media_type).toBe("application/pdf"); |
| expect(body.messages[0].content[1].type).toBe("text"); |
| }); |
|
|
| it("anthropicAnalyzePdf throws on API error", async () => { |
| const { anthropicAnalyzePdf } = await import("./pdf-native-providers.js"); |
| mockFetchResponse({ |
| ok: false, |
| status: 400, |
| statusText: "Bad Request", |
| text: async () => "invalid request", |
| }); |
|
|
| await expect(anthropicAnalyzePdf(makeAnthropicAnalyzeParams())).rejects.toThrow( |
| "Anthropic PDF request failed", |
| ); |
| }); |
|
|
| it("anthropicAnalyzePdf throws when response has no text", async () => { |
| const { anthropicAnalyzePdf } = await import("./pdf-native-providers.js"); |
| mockFetchResponse({ |
| ok: true, |
| json: async () => ({ |
| content: [{ type: "text", text: " " }], |
| }), |
| }); |
|
|
| await expect(anthropicAnalyzePdf(makeAnthropicAnalyzeParams())).rejects.toThrow( |
| "Anthropic PDF returned no text", |
| ); |
| }); |
|
|
| it("geminiAnalyzePdf sends correct request shape", async () => { |
| const { geminiAnalyzePdf } = await import("./pdf-native-providers.js"); |
| const fetchMock = mockFetchResponse({ |
| ok: true, |
| json: async () => ({ |
| candidates: [ |
| { |
| content: { parts: [{ text: "Gemini PDF analysis" }] }, |
| }, |
| ], |
| }), |
| }); |
|
|
| const result = await geminiAnalyzePdf({ |
| ...makeGeminiAnalyzeParams({ |
| modelId: "gemini-2.5-pro", |
| prompt: "Summarize this", |
| }), |
| }); |
|
|
| expect(result).toBe("Gemini PDF analysis"); |
| expect(fetchMock).toHaveBeenCalledTimes(1); |
| const [url, opts] = fetchMock.mock.calls[0]; |
| expect(url).toContain("generateContent"); |
| expect(url).toContain("gemini-2.5-pro"); |
| const body = JSON.parse(opts.body); |
| expect(body.contents[0].parts).toHaveLength(2); |
| expect(body.contents[0].parts[0].inline_data.mime_type).toBe("application/pdf"); |
| expect(body.contents[0].parts[1].text).toBe("Summarize this"); |
| }); |
|
|
| it("geminiAnalyzePdf throws on API error", async () => { |
| const { geminiAnalyzePdf } = await import("./pdf-native-providers.js"); |
| mockFetchResponse({ |
| ok: false, |
| status: 500, |
| statusText: "Internal Server Error", |
| text: async () => "server error", |
| }); |
|
|
| await expect(geminiAnalyzePdf(makeGeminiAnalyzeParams())).rejects.toThrow( |
| "Gemini PDF request failed", |
| ); |
| }); |
|
|
| it("geminiAnalyzePdf throws when no candidates returned", async () => { |
| const { geminiAnalyzePdf } = await import("./pdf-native-providers.js"); |
| mockFetchResponse({ |
| ok: true, |
| json: async () => ({ candidates: [] }), |
| }); |
|
|
| await expect(geminiAnalyzePdf(makeGeminiAnalyzeParams())).rejects.toThrow( |
| "Gemini PDF returned no candidates", |
| ); |
| }); |
|
|
| it("anthropicAnalyzePdf supports multiple PDFs", async () => { |
| const { anthropicAnalyzePdf } = await import("./pdf-native-providers.js"); |
| const fetchMock = mockFetchResponse({ |
| ok: true, |
| json: async () => ({ |
| content: [{ type: "text", text: "Multi-doc analysis" }], |
| }), |
| }); |
|
|
| await anthropicAnalyzePdf({ |
| ...makeAnthropicAnalyzeParams({ |
| modelId: "claude-opus-4-6", |
| prompt: "Compare these documents", |
| pdfs: [ |
| { base64: "cGRmMQ==", filename: "doc1.pdf" }, |
| { base64: "cGRmMg==", filename: "doc2.pdf" }, |
| ], |
| }), |
| }); |
|
|
| const body = JSON.parse(fetchMock.mock.calls[0][1].body); |
| |
| expect(body.messages[0].content).toHaveLength(3); |
| expect(body.messages[0].content[0].type).toBe("document"); |
| expect(body.messages[0].content[1].type).toBe("document"); |
| expect(body.messages[0].content[2].type).toBe("text"); |
| }); |
|
|
| it("anthropicAnalyzePdf uses custom base URL", async () => { |
| const { anthropicAnalyzePdf } = await import("./pdf-native-providers.js"); |
| const fetchMock = mockFetchResponse({ |
| ok: true, |
| json: async () => ({ |
| content: [{ type: "text", text: "ok" }], |
| }), |
| }); |
|
|
| await anthropicAnalyzePdf({ |
| ...makeAnthropicAnalyzeParams({ baseUrl: "https://custom.example.com" }), |
| }); |
|
|
| expect(fetchMock.mock.calls[0][0]).toContain("https://custom.example.com/v1/messages"); |
| }); |
|
|
| it("anthropicAnalyzePdf requires apiKey", async () => { |
| const { anthropicAnalyzePdf } = await import("./pdf-native-providers.js"); |
| await expect(anthropicAnalyzePdf(makeAnthropicAnalyzeParams({ apiKey: "" }))).rejects.toThrow( |
| "apiKey required", |
| ); |
| }); |
|
|
| it("geminiAnalyzePdf requires apiKey", async () => { |
| const { geminiAnalyzePdf } = await import("./pdf-native-providers.js"); |
| await expect(geminiAnalyzePdf(makeGeminiAnalyzeParams({ apiKey: "" }))).rejects.toThrow( |
| "apiKey required", |
| ); |
| }); |
|
|
| it("geminiAnalyzePdf does not duplicate /v1beta when baseUrl already includes it", async () => { |
| const { geminiAnalyzePdf } = await import("./pdf-native-providers.js"); |
| const fetchMock = mockFetchResponse({ |
| ok: true, |
| json: async () => ({ |
| candidates: [{ content: { parts: [{ text: "ok" }] } }], |
| }), |
| }); |
|
|
| await geminiAnalyzePdf( |
| makeGeminiAnalyzeParams({ |
| baseUrl: "https://generativelanguage.googleapis.com/v1beta", |
| }), |
| ); |
|
|
| const [url] = fetchMock.mock.calls[0]; |
| expect(url).toContain("/v1beta/models/"); |
| expect(url).not.toContain("/v1beta/v1beta"); |
| }); |
| }); |
